How can I distract Miss Gristle?

  • 1 of 14: Notice that Miss Gristle hates muddy footprints. Particularly those caused by the gorilla.
  • 2 of 14: Perhaps we could cause the gorilla to make a bit of a mess?
  • 3 of 14: Notice that if you try to talk to the gorilla, he gets up, walks around a bit, then lays back on his sofa.
  • 4 of 14: Also notice that his feet are selectable. Let's muddy 'em up ;)
  • 5 of 14: To make mud, you need two components. Liquid, and dirt.
  • 6 of 14: The dirt, or soil, can be found out on the balcony where we began the chapter.
  • 7 of 14: As for the liquid... well, we're in a mansion aren't we?
  • 8 of 14: Maybe we could have the help provide us with a drink?
  • 9 of 14: Speak with Miss Gristle and eventually the conversation will turn to asking for a glass of lemonade.
  • 10 of 14: She will rush off to get you some (and will return if you try to enter Doctor T's office).
  • 11 of 14: When she returns, you can put the soil into the bottle of lemonade to create mud.
  • 12 of 14: Rub it on the gorilla's feet, and speak with him again, and he will leave a nice collection of muddy footprints on the clean floor.
  • 13 of 14: You now only need to pop back upstairs and alert Miss Gristle to the newly-dirtied floor.
  • 14 of 14: She won't be pleased, but she'll step away from the door and allow you inside. :)
